complexType DimensionType
diagram index_p19.png
namespace urn:oasis:names:tc:unitsml:schema:xsd:UnitsMLSchema_lite-0.9.18
children Length Mass Time ElectricCurrent ThermodynamicTemperature AmountOfSubstance LuminousIntensity
used by
element Dimension
attributes
Name  Type  Use  Default  Fixed  annotation
idrequired      
documentation
See http://www.w3.org/TR/xml-id/ for
                     information about this attribute.
dimensionlessxsd:booleanoptional  0    
documentation
Boolean to designate that a quantity or unit is dimensionless.
annotation
documentation
Type for dimension.
source <xsd:complexType name="DimensionType">
 
<xsd:annotation>
   
<xsd:documentation>Type for dimension.</xsd:documentation>
 
</xsd:annotation>
 
<xsd:sequence maxOccurs="unbounded">
   
<xsd:annotation>
     
<xsd:documentation>This unbounded sequence allows any order of any number of elements; e.g., L^1 · L^-1.</xsd:documentation>
   
</xsd:annotation>
   
<xsd:element ref="Length" minOccurs="0"/>
   
<xsd:element ref="Mass" minOccurs="0"/>
   
<xsd:element ref="Time" minOccurs="0"/>
   
<xsd:element ref="ElectricCurrent" minOccurs="0"/>
   
<xsd:element ref="ThermodynamicTemperature" minOccurs="0"/>
   
<xsd:element ref="AmountOfSubstance" minOccurs="0"/>
   
<xsd:element ref="LuminousIntensity" minOccurs="0"/>
 
</xsd:sequence>
 
<xsd:attribute ref="xml:id" use="required"/>
 
<xsd:attribute name="dimensionless" type="xsd:boolean" use="optional" default="0">
   
<xsd:annotation>
     
<xsd:documentation>Boolean to designate that a quantity or unit is dimensionless.</xsd:documentation>
   
</xsd:annotation>
 
</xsd:attribute>
</xsd:complexType>

fixed M
use optional
annotation
documentation
Symbol of the quantity mass.
source <xsd:attribute name="symbol" type="xsd:token" use="optional" fixed="M">
 
<xsd:annotation>
   
<xsd:documentation>Symbol of the quantity mass.</xsd:documentation>
 
</xsd:annotation>
</xsd:attribute>

complexType NameType
diagram index_p25.png
namespace urn:oasis:names:tc:unitsml:schema:xsd:UnitsMLSchema_lite-0.9.18
type extension of xsd:token
properties
base xsd:token
used by
element UnitName
attributes
Name  Type  Use  Default  Fixed  annotation
lang      
documentation
Attempting to install the relevant ISO 2- and 3-letter
         codes as the enumerated possible values is probably never
         going to be a realistic possibility.  See
         RFC 3066 at http://www.ietf.org/rfc/rfc3066.txt and the IANA registry
         at http://www.iana.org/assignments/lang-tag-apps.htm for
         further information.

         The union allows for the 'un-declaration' of xml:lang with
         the empty string.
annotation
documentation
Type for name.  Used for names in units, quantities, and prefixes.
source <xsd:complexType name="NameType">
 
<xsd:annotation>
   
<xsd:documentation>Type for name.  Used for names in units, quantities, and prefixes.</xsd:documentation>
 
</xsd:annotation>
 
<xsd:simpleContent>
   
<xsd:extension base="xsd:token">
     
<xsd:attribute ref="xml:lang"/>
   
</xsd:extension>
 
</xsd:simpleContent>
</xsd:complexType>
